Months Kabul Santo Domingo
Jan–Mar 45°/25°F (8°/-4°C) 85°/67°F (29°/20°C)
Apr–Jun 76°/48°F (25°/9°C) 87°/72°F (30°/22°C)
Jul–Sep 88°/56°F (31°/13°C) 89°/73°F (31°/23°C)
Oct–Dec 59°/31°F (15°/-1°C) 87°/71°F (30°/21°C)

What's the weather like in Dominican Republic compared to Afghanistan?

The average high temperature in Santo Domingo is 87°F, compared to 67°F in Kabul. Santo Domingo receives around 57.0 in of rainfall per year, while Kabul gets 12.3 in.

What language do they speak in Dominican Republic?

The official language in Dominican Republic is Spanish. In Afghanistan, the official languages are Dari, Pashto and Turkmen.
